The information within the L293d Motor Driver Datasheet allows you to connect the driver to a microcontroller (like an Arduino) and control the direction and speed of DC motors. It specifies the voltage and current limitations, ensuring that you don’t overload the chip and cause it to fail. It also outlines the logic levels required for the input pins, enabling you to program your microcontroller to send the correct signals to drive the motors as desired. Below is a table that summarizes some key information often found in the datasheet.

Parameter Description
VCC1 Supply voltage for logic circuitry
VCC2 Supply voltage for motor drive
Iout Output current per channel
